Facile preparation of SERS-active nanogap-rich Au nanoleaves
Hong, Jin-Hyung,Hwang, Yong-Kyung,Hong, Jin-Yeon,Kim, Hee-Jin,Kim, Sung-Jin,Won, Yong Sun,Huh, Seong
body text, p. 6963 - 6965 (2011/08/08)
To simply reduce HAuCl4 using 2-thiophenemethanol in an aqueous solution at room temperature, a novel metallic Au nanostructure with a high SERS activity was obtained. Flat sheet-like Au nanoleaves possessing many nanogap hotspots bound with a large percentage of high-index facets were obtained.
